This Thursday, the Girondins of Bordeauxsix-time champion of Francedeclared bankruptcy after being relegated to the country’s third division due to financial problems. The decision came after the French Football League (LFP) review the club’s accounts at the end of last season and determine the punishment due to financial failure.
With the bankruptcy declaration, Bordeaux has abandoned its status as a professional club, resulting in the termination of the contracts of all players in the squad. These players are now free on the market and can be signed directly by other teams, without the need for negotiations with Bordeaux. In addition to the loss of the squad, the club’s training center will be closed, affecting around 70 young players, as reported by the French press.

The third tier of French football includes both professional and amateur clubs. Generally, relegated teams lose their professional status, but can apply for a two-year exemption to maintain recognition. However, given the current crisis, Bordeaux have chosen not to seek this temporary remedy.
To overcome the crisis, Bordeaux will have to present a budget to the National Directorate of Management Control (DNCG), the entity responsible for monitoring the finances of professional clubs in France.
Throughout its history, Bordeaux has had renowned players such as Zidane, Pauletaand Brazilian athletes like the full-back Marianothe defender Pablo and the attacker Malcolm. The club won the French Championship in 1950, 1984, 1985, 1987, 1999 and 2009, as well as titles in the French Cup, French Super Cup It is French League Cup.
